NIEP welcomes Sierra Club as its Institutional member
NIEP welcomes Sierra Club as the proud institutional member of Network of Indian Environment Professionals.
The Sierra Club’s members are more than 750,000 of your friends and neighbors. Inspired by nature, they work together to protect our communities and the planet. The Club is America’s oldest, largest and most influential grassroots environmental organization.
